Iceland - Treatment and Disposal of Non-hazardous Waste Turnover Per Employee
Since 2015, Iceland Treatment and Disposal of Non-Hazardous Waste Turnover Per Employee was up 6% year on year. At €172.1 Thousand in 2018, the country was number 11 comparing other countries in Treatment and Disposal of Non-Hazardous Waste Turnover Per Employee. Iceland is overtaken by United Kingdom, which was number 10 with €183.6 Thousand and is followed by Ireland at €169.6 Thousand. Norway topped the ranking with €408.2 Thousand in 2019, +3.6% versus 2018. Luxembourg, Austria and Slovenia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Slovenia witnessed the best average annual growth at +21.9% per year, while Belgium was the worst growing country at -5.5% per year.
